About this role
Sumsub is the first AI-powered trust infrastructure for compliance operations at scale. It connects identity and business verification, fraud prevention, transaction monitoring, and risk workflows, helping teams reduce manual work and enter new markets. Trusted by over 4,000 clients across financial services, crypto, mobility, trading, marketplaces, education, and iGaming, including Bybit, Bitpanda, Wirex, Avis, Vodafone, Duolingo, Kaizen Gaming, and Bancaribe. Sumsub is recognized as a Great Place To Work® in the US and rated 4.3 out of 5 on Glassdoor. Our 1,000+ people around the world back it up, too: 92% are proud to be Sumsubers, and 90% say their work is interesting and challenging. Now we are looking for a Product GTM Manager to drive the global expansion of our KYB solution on a global scale. What You Will Be Doing: Develop and execute a global Go-to-Market strategy of the solutions in scope Lead the overall sales strategy across all major global markets, ensuring alignment with the company’s global growth objectives Support product adoption within key customer groups globally Support high-value deals and negotiations, acting as a Subject Matter Expert Lead the enablement of all relevant teams on the solution in scope Drive revenue growth through strategic planning, ensuring revenue targets and business KPIs are met Identify new market opportunities, develop regional expansion strategies, drive sales in key industries and adoption within key customer groups Conduct high-level competitive analysis and implement proactive strategies to strengthen market positioning Work closely with marketing, product, legal, sales and customer success teams to ensure seamless execution of GTM initiatives About You: 5+ years of sales experience, experience in selling KYB products is a must Deep understanding of the KYB trends, including industry and geographic specificities and competitive landscapes Demonstrated success in driving revenue growth, managing large enterprise deals, and expanding into new markets Proven track record of bringing new complex products to the market Experience in designing and executing go-to-market strategies for regional and global expansion while staying agile in a fast-changing business environment Have excellent interpersonal skills, including the ability to work across a matrixed organisation, influencing, negotiating effectively with leadership and peers Experience in running large-scale education programs for 100+ people Proficiency in using sales analytics, CRM tools (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ot), and data-driven decision-making Bachelor's degree in Business, Marketing, or a related field; MBA preferred.
